How I can help

I’m a UKCP-registered Person-Centred Psychotherapist with experience across psychiatric half-way houses, NHS services, low-cost counselling centres and private practice. Alongside individual therapy, I work with people in relationship psychotherapy, supporting couples and relational pairings who want to understand patterns, improve communication, or navigate change together. This includes romantic partners, friends, family members, and other meaningful relationships — not just traditional couples. My work focuses on the therapeutic relationship as the primary agent of change, creating a space where each person feels heard, respected, and able to speak honestly. I hold complexity, difference and conflict with care, helping clients explore how they relate to themselves and to others, and what they want their relationships to become.

About me

I’m Nilima, a therapist who believes therapy works best when it’s human, honest, and allowed to be a little curious. I offer a warm, non-judgemental space where you can bring the complicated, contradictory, and not-quite-finished parts of yourself.

Before training as a psychotherapist, I worked as a journalist and editor in national media and specialist publications, and later in private equity, funding my therapy training. That path shaped how I listen, how I think about stories and power, and how comfortable I am with complexity, pressure, and difference.

Outside the therapy room, I enjoy films, reading, and running, and I co-host a science fiction podcast. I’m interested in how people make meaning, how relationships evolve, and how change happens over time — themes that turn up as much in good sci-fi as they do in therapy.
